From ce0e244923f9e28634b8b0f8169ae56bbcc0b4db Mon Sep 17 00:00:00 2001 From: Mike Frysinger Date: Mon, 8 Jan 2007 04:47:09 +0000 Subject: [PATCH] Force binutils-2.17+ to make sure the assembler supports secureplt #160709. Package-Manager: portage-2.1.2_rc4-r6 --- sys-devel/gcc/ChangeLog | 6 +++++- sys-devel/gcc/Manifest | 34 ++++++++++++++++++++----------- sys-devel/gcc/gcc-4.1.1-r1.ebuild | 6 ++++-- sys-devel/gcc/gcc-4.1.1-r3.ebuild | 4 +++- 4 files changed, 34 insertions(+), 16 deletions(-) diff --git a/sys-devel/gcc/ChangeLog b/sys-devel/gcc/ChangeLog index d64f0085de66..3d96c4a02a30 100644 --- a/sys-devel/gcc/ChangeLog +++ b/sys-devel/gcc/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for sys-devel/gcc #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/ChangeLog,v 1.599 2007/01/08 03:05:49 jer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/ChangeLog,v 1.600 2007/01/08 04:47:09 vapier Exp $ + + 08 Jan 2007; Mike Frysinger gcc-4.1.1-r1.ebuild, + gcc-4.1.1-r3.ebuild: + Force binutils-2.17+ to make sure the assembler supports secureplt #160709. 08 Jan 2007; Jeroen Roovers gcc-4.1.1-r3.ebuild: Stable for HPPA (bug #160663). diff --git a/sys-devel/gcc/Manifest b/sys-devel/gcc/Manifest index 613bb0e74232..c9d9fdd1ae1c 100644 --- a/sys-devel/gcc/Manifest +++ b/sys-devel/gcc/Manifest @@ -1,3 +1,6 @@ +-----BEGIN PGP SIGNED MESSAGE----- +Hash: SHA1 + AUX 3.2.1/gcc31-loop-load-final-value.patch 3324 RMD160 8bb0e9133923821daf2e9d10a27a0a1930e00bbd SHA1 c73dc6e19a76a1dcbb11a15ff5ff04b11a9f0343 SHA256 70aa8433fb19c95f334b6cbc155cae22a3b61a6892ed9e18f95860509d0091a8 MD5 8ec9b0352d226e4693cabffe0fa5bba6 files/3.2.1/gcc31-loop-load-final-value.patch 3324 RMD160 8bb0e9133923821daf2e9d10a27a0a1930e00bbd files/3.2.1/gcc31-loop-load-final-value.patch 3324 @@ -442,14 +445,14 @@ EBUILD gcc-4.1.0_alpha20061208.ebuild 1961 RMD160 fa6a04348d7afb579a86a4425499c8 MD5 d4f519a40cd8212a0c2fc5d5bf7e2ba1 gcc-4.1.0_alpha20061208.ebuild 1961 RMD160 fa6a04348d7afb579a86a4425499c8c65e76dd38 gcc-4.1.0_alpha20061208.ebuild 1961 SHA256 a14185f453697a20303e16300e806301de28ba620dc13c208533c59c17fde456 gcc-4.1.0_alpha20061208.ebuild 1961 -EBUILD gcc-4.1.1-r1.ebuild 1904 RMD160 8f20659fc6cb1cb3131f1bde485871cf10056bfc SHA1 09ffab098c9d098eae903666074554eb8c45eb21 SHA256 877818ef03896fdedfde7a5c7e6794abed9d6d740dd1b0b145205ebd6d2e2648 -MD5 9740bb001dd12d3c2cbf3dcc144429d1 gcc-4.1.1-r1.ebuild 1904 -RMD160 8f20659fc6cb1cb3131f1bde485871cf10056bfc gcc-4.1.1-r1.ebuild 1904 -SHA256 877818ef03896fdedfde7a5c7e6794abed9d6d740dd1b0b145205ebd6d2e2648 gcc-4.1.1-r1.ebuild 1904 -EBUILD gcc-4.1.1-r3.ebuild 1902 RMD160 d415d3b60e2e088e24fefde73f0f93f9c6c1f9ea SHA1 150443468c86cfce80ee09a44b1f02fa578f2b53 SHA256 1d58e7d95e70ed7aa450b92e887efc723e32911efef8423d44945bbe8c5fafd9 -MD5 202b9e32fec36478ac6f1ad92756ffaa gcc-4.1.1-r3.ebuild 1902 -RMD160 d415d3b60e2e088e24fefde73f0f93f9c6c1f9ea gcc-4.1.1-r3.ebuild 1902 -SHA256 1d58e7d95e70ed7aa450b92e887efc723e32911efef8423d44945bbe8c5fafd9 gcc-4.1.1-r3.ebuild 1902 +EBUILD gcc-4.1.1-r1.ebuild 1982 RMD160 5c1266c5b39526b8417e95c9e184d8b6de54a6b6 SHA1 fe75200db1cee67354d707e4fa63a376a3d981fc SHA256 2f02f8729217c0f646c6433ba53b8bb3cfdac94bb604c0a176afba571e4991a4 +MD5 e0865c95175a0749bee56f6b1c8801fa gcc-4.1.1-r1.ebuild 1982 +RMD160 5c1266c5b39526b8417e95c9e184d8b6de54a6b6 gcc-4.1.1-r1.ebuild 1982 +SHA256 2f02f8729217c0f646c6433ba53b8bb3cfdac94bb604c0a176afba571e4991a4 gcc-4.1.1-r1.ebuild 1982 +EBUILD gcc-4.1.1-r3.ebuild 1983 RMD160 6dae458a56a592b804acb25ca6733fc25bce4715 SHA1 b2df18ba26968df20d77616f13e01d69e68e8ff2 SHA256 5bcae6536e8d0fcdc2b43b0771116f68cbd5696f3d27cd4534182951924e44e0 +MD5 06281cd332cd20967014b338a15c3e3c gcc-4.1.1-r3.ebuild 1983 +RMD160 6dae458a56a592b804acb25ca6733fc25bce4715 gcc-4.1.1-r3.ebuild 1983 +SHA256 5bcae6536e8d0fcdc2b43b0771116f68cbd5696f3d27cd4534182951924e44e0 gcc-4.1.1-r3.ebuild 1983 EBUILD gcc-4.1.1.ebuild 1869 RMD160 f5ba64e4c8e048dea4c1777b51c373705d578988 SHA1 8c40fe9c3915bb10362a242bbd26f7fe9791f65c SHA256 48c6093a0295f010aef8f137da79f94ff5ad4a0dd58b11b24ed6a7bf4c6c652a MD5 eff84669b7a3409e11082d235b5da2c2 gcc-4.1.1.ebuild 1869 RMD160 f5ba64e4c8e048dea4c1777b51c373705d578988 gcc-4.1.1.ebuild 1869 @@ -462,10 +465,10 @@ EBUILD gcc-4.3.0_alpha20061216.ebuild 1944 RMD160 50c1598eaed60033c1c8790d2d0ea0 MD5 1b243f78851d9c921e466fa9987b885b gcc-4.3.0_alpha20061216.ebuild 1944 RMD160 50c1598eaed60033c1c8790d2d0ea04e2b1a72c2 gcc-4.3.0_alpha20061216.ebuild 1944 SHA256 0325decf1c07715304247d4278fd9e713a627c1658a76928e8f68db4a7c72a5c gcc-4.3.0_alpha20061216.ebuild 1944 -MISC ChangeLog 117379 RMD160 bfba72556439eb437d4102825077ebee91332d1f SHA1 822ef1ec67589764eb0615084c32c824b2f0b7a2 SHA256 97833a8ccdf2ae79e8eb8b85a815cbfad52aab8383c08a554ad5bd9daa44c9d3 -MD5 a855374d53d5b56ac7fe47c33d2a6bd2 ChangeLog 117379 -RMD160 bfba72556439eb437d4102825077ebee91332d1f ChangeLog 117379 -SHA256 97833a8ccdf2ae79e8eb8b85a815cbfad52aab8383c08a554ad5bd9daa44c9d3 ChangeLog 117379 +MISC ChangeLog 117555 RMD160 5b33c0a435e6b896ac5d1f12beb7b3fa1b80def7 SHA1 eebe01b610ecffd51ead2ae539408452c15eac94 SHA256 b1bca754b065bc23879466f87cbceafa88d603b0a8e161a8b54e2d9894005edc +MD5 152fb6b683cc2a036994a2364ea6620f ChangeLog 117555 +RMD160 5b33c0a435e6b896ac5d1f12beb7b3fa1b80def7 ChangeLog 117555 +SHA256 b1bca754b065bc23879466f87cbceafa88d603b0a8e161a8b54e2d9894005edc ChangeLog 117555 MISC metadata.xml 162 RMD160 d002486a43522f2116b1d9d59828c484956d66e2 SHA1 d6b4923897f6ae673b4f93646f5b4ba61d5a2c3c SHA256 65a915d44de1f01d4b7f72d313b4192c38374a9835d24988c00c1e73dca5805a MD5 567094e03359ffc1c95af7356395228d metadata.xml 162 RMD160 d002486a43522f2116b1d9d59828c484956d66e2 metadata.xml 162 @@ -545,3 +548,10 @@ SHA256 ec12ba6e776244ea9cfc08dadf56bfbef96d9cb11a422fb4bb475e6b7f52def6 files/di MD5 388e955f31d3e6c7020dd5018fe77125 files/digest-gcc-4.3.0_alpha20061216 259 RMD160 5a41a2e2d597f2b212042fc0409649bc46bee774 files/digest-gcc-4.3.0_alpha20061216 259 SHA256 d3dec252b404412347f769d5e7e777fecea58c09c7116bf9f19694d245af7533 files/digest-gcc-4.3.0_alpha20061216 259 +-----BEGIN PGP SIGNATURE----- +Version: GnuPG v2.0.1 (GNU/Linux) + +iD8DBQFFoczi8bi6rjpTunYRAiKVAJ91sPkXaV3oJwhNYw/Nu6XzX2La7gCfeVim +l2b+BbyDh60ce32FT2TlDpA= +=3GpZ +-----END PGP SIGNATURE----- diff --git a/sys-devel/gcc/gcc-4.1.1-r1.ebuild b/sys-devel/gcc/gcc-4.1.1-r1.ebuild index c83f08295082..a79b8ac09d40 100644 --- a/sys-devel/gcc/gcc-4.1.1-r1.ebuild +++ b/sys-devel/gcc/gcc-4.1.1-r1.ebuild @@ -1,6 +1,6 @@ -# Copyright 1999-2006 Gentoo Foundation +# Copyright 1999-2007 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-4.1.1-r1.ebuild,v 1.16 2006/12/26 21:37:03 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-4.1.1-r1.ebuild,v 1.17 2007/01/08 04:47:09 vapier Exp $ PATCH_VER="1.7.1" UCLIBC_VER="1.1" @@ -41,6 +41,8 @@ DEPEND="${RDEPEND} test? ( sys-devel/autogen dev-util/dejagnu ) >=sys-apps/texinfo-4.2-r4 >=sys-devel/bison-1.875 + ppc? ( >=${CATEGORY}/binutils-2.17 ) + ppc64? ( >=${CATEGORY}/binutils-2.17 ) >=${CATEGORY}/binutils-2.15.94" PDEPEND="|| ( sys-devel/gcc-config app-admin/eselect-compiler )" if [[ ${CATEGORY} != cross-* ]] ; then diff --git a/sys-devel/gcc/gcc-4.1.1-r3.ebuild b/sys-devel/gcc/gcc-4.1.1-r3.ebuild index 4e74e4d2824d..7ef6a2adcd5f 100644 --- a/sys-devel/gcc/gcc-4.1.1-r3.ebuild +++ b/sys-devel/gcc/gcc-4.1.1-r3.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2007 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-4.1.1-r3.ebuild,v 1.4 2007/01/08 03:05:49 jer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-devel/gcc/gcc-4.1.1-r3.ebuild,v 1.5 2007/01/08 04:47:09 vapier Exp $ PATCH_VER="1.9" UCLIBC_VER="1.1" @@ -41,6 +41,8 @@ DEPEND="${RDEPEND} test? ( sys-devel/autogen dev-util/dejagnu ) >=sys-apps/texinfo-4.2-r4 >=sys-devel/bison-1.875 + ppc? ( >=${CATEGORY}/binutils-2.17 ) + ppc64? ( >=${CATEGORY}/binutils-2.17 ) >=${CATEGORY}/binutils-2.15.94" PDEPEND="|| ( sys-devel/gcc-config app-admin/eselect-compiler )" if [[ ${CATEGORY} != cross-* ]] ; then -- 2.26.2